Tips for PCO Drivers to Minimise Downtime
Downtime is the time you are not driving or earning during your working hours. It’s one of the biggest fears for private hire drivers because high downtime means low earnings. For drivers on a PCO car hire plan, avoiding downtime is even more critical to keep up with their weekly fees.
Many factors cause downtime, including vehicle breakdowns and working in areas with low demand. Fortunately, you can maximise your driving hours with these few simple habits mentioned below.

Care for Your Car
A neglected car breaks down often. Keep your car maintained to avoid breakdowns and enjoy smooth rides.
Although PCO hire companies service their vehicles regularly, it’s still your responsibility to keep your car in good condition. Do a pre-shift inspection daily. Walk around your car and check your tyre pressure. Low tyre pressure increases fuel consumption and the risk of punctures, causing downtime.
Next, check your fluid levels. Open the bonnet once a week to look at the coolant reservoir. Check the brake fluid and top up your screen wash. Low fluid levels affect your car’s performance and may also get you fined during a TfL spot check.
Use Multiple Apps
Do not rely on one platform. Use multiple apps because when Uber is quiet, Bolt might be surging. Diversifying the sources of ride requests is a basic tactic to minimise downtime.
However, make sure you don’t use all the apps at once. You might get overlapping requests, and declining requests can affect your cancellation score. Instead, use apps smartly. Make Uber your primary app during standard peaks. When the requests slow down, go offline on Uber and switch your focus to Bolt. Check its heat map to see where demand is rising.
Knowing when to switch an app keeps you on top of slow hours.

And Manage Your Schedule Smartly
Plan your day with purpose. Demand on weekdays surges in the mornings and evenings. However, weekends have completely different demand patterns.
Your driving area is also important.
Sunday mornings in Canary Wharf are quiet because businesses are closed. However, Sunday mornings in Camden Market are busy due to tourists.
Learn London’s demand zones to match your time and location. This will help minimise the downtime between rides.
Use Navigation Apps
Use navigation apps like Google Maps or Apple Maps to save time. These apps show traffic jams in real time and suggest quick alternative routes.
Turn on surge notifications and congestion zone alerts to be in the right place at the right time. Some drivers use a second phone to monitor the traffic map in London. A crash on the motorway can affect demand on connected routes. Knowing this early will help you avoid downtime.
In addition, identify your busiest times and most profitable areas. Use this information to determine what works and what doesn’t.

Prepare for Weather and Events
The demand spikes instantly in the rain as people avoid public transport and open their apps to book minicabs. Check the forecast each morning. If the rain is predicted for 3:00 pm, be in the central zone by 2:45 pm and wait for the surge.
Major events also drive massive demand. Check London’s event calendar to note the concert times. Mark football matches at Wembley and see theatre openings. Your job is to be near the venue before the event ends to find more passengers with little to no downtime.
Plan for Emergencies
Things can go wrong at any time. A tyre may go flat, or the engine may fail. Sometimes, passengers can have emergencies as well.
Keep an emergency kit in your car for such situations. It should have a powerful torch and a tyre inflator. Jumper cables are also vital. However, your most important item is a phone charger because a dead phone means zero earnings.
Save your hire company’s emergency number for roadside assistance in case of breakdowns. Some reliable companies also offer replacement vehicles if your car is due for lengthy repairs. Make sure your car provider offers it to avoid downtime.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is downtime for PCO drivers?
Downtime is any period when you’re logged in and working but not earning, usually due to low demand, traffic, or vehicle issues.
How can proper vehicle care reduce downtime?
Regular checks on tyres, fluids, and general condition help prevent breakdowns and avoid delays caused by mechanical issues.
Should I use more than one ride-hailing app?
Yes. Using apps like Uber and Bolt together helps you stay busy. If one app is quiet, the other may have higher demand.
Can navigation apps help minimise downtime?
Absolutely. Apps like Google Maps or Apple Maps help avoid traffic congestion, suggest quicker routes, and keep you productive on the road.
Why should PCO drivers plan for weather and events?
Rain and major events increase demand instantly. Being nearby before they start or end ensures fast pickups and less idle time.
